The Healing Time for Breast Implant Removal in Boston

Breast implant removal, also known as explantation, is a surgical procedure that involves the removal of breast implants that were previously placed for cosmetic or reconstructive purposes. This procedure is often sought by individuals who are experiencing complications or are dissatisfied with the appearance or function of their breast implants. If you are considering breast implant removal in Boston, it's essential to understand the expected healing time and the factors that can influence the recovery process. The healing time for breast implant removal can vary depending on several factors, including the type of implant removal procedure, the individual's overall health, and the extent of the surgical intervention. In general, the healing process can be divided into several stages: 1. Immediate Post-Operative Period: - Immediately after the surgery, patients may experience swelling, bruising, and discomfort in the chest area. - Pain medication and compression garments are typically prescribed to manage these symptoms. - During this time, it's essential to follow the surgeon's instructions regarding activity restrictions and wound care. 2. Early Recovery: - Within the first few days to a week, the initial swelling and discomfort typically begin to subside. - Patients may be able to resume light activities, such as walking, as tolerated. - Sutures or surgical glue used to close the incisions will gradually heal. 3. Mid-Recovery: - Over the next few weeks, the incisions continue to heal, and the swelling further reduces. - Patients may be able to gradually increase their physical activity, as long as they avoid any strenuous exercises or heavy lifting. - Regular follow-up appointments with the surgeon are necessary to monitor the healing progress. 4. Long-Term Recovery: - After several weeks to a few months, the majority of the physical healing process is complete. - Patients may continue to experience some residual swelling or discomfort, which can take several months to fully resolve. - The final results of the breast implant removal procedure will become more apparent as the body continues to heal and adapt. It's important to note that the healing time for breast implant removal can vary significantly from individual to individual. Factors such as the type of implant removal (e.g., en-bloc vs. partial removal), the presence of scar tissue, and the patient's overall health can all impact the recovery process.

Choosing a Qualified Surgeon for Breast Implant Removal in Boston

When considering breast implant removal in Boston, it's crucial to choose a qualified and experienced plastic surgeon who specializes in this procedure. Here are some factors to consider when selecting a surgeon: 1. Board Certification: - Ensure that the surgeon is board-certified in plastic surgery, which demonstrates their advanced training and expertise in the field. 2. Specialization in Breast Implant Removal: - Look for a surgeon who has a specific focus on breast implant removal and has extensive experience performing this procedure. 3. Patient Reviews and Testimonials: - Research the surgeon's reputation by reading patient reviews and testimonials to get a sense of their bedside manner, surgical outcomes, and overall patient satisfaction. 4. Consultation and Communication: - During the initial consultation, pay attention to the surgeon's communication style and their willingness to address your concerns and answer your questions. 5. Hospital Affiliations and Accreditations: - Consider choosing a surgeon who operates at accredited facilities, as this can indicate their commitment to providing high-quality and safe surgical care. By selecting a qualified and experienced plastic surgeon in Boston, you can maximize the chances of a smooth and successful breast implant removal procedure, as well as a comfortable and efficient recovery process.

FAQ: Breast Implant Removal in Boston

1. How long does the breast implant removal surgery typically take? - The duration of the breast implant removal surgery can vary, but it generally takes 1 to 2 hours to complete. 2. Will I need to wear a compression garment after the surgery? - Yes, most surgeons will recommend wearing a compression garment or sports bra for several weeks after the surgery to help with swelling and support the chest area during the healing process. 3. Can I return to my normal activities after the surgery? - The timeline for resuming normal activities can vary, but most patients are able to gradually return to their regular routines within a few weeks to a few months, depending on the complexity of the procedure and their individual healing progress. 4. Will my breasts look different after the implants are removed? - The appearance of the breasts after implant removal can vary, depending on factors such as the size and type of the original implants, the amount of natural breast tissue, and the presence of any scarring or changes to the breast shape over time. 5. Are there any risks associated with breast implant removal? - As with any surgical procedure, there are potential risks and complications associated with breast implant removal, such as bleeding, infection, and aesthetic concerns. Your surgeon will discuss these risks with you during the consultation and help you make an informed decision.
